Cooking Techniques
- Rinse canned black beans well to reduce excess salt.
- Add a squeeze of lime juice before serving to brighten the flavors.
Step 1
Gently heat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a big bowl, mix together the chicken, red bell pepper, red onion, sour cream, cream cheese, taco seasoning, and a pinch of salt until everything’s well combined. In another bowl, stir the black beans with hot water and cumin, then mash them roughly with a fork so it’s all mixed but still a bit chunky.
Step 2
Grab a 9x9-inch baking dish and layer three tortillas on the bottom. Spread half of the salsa over the tortillas, then half of the black bean mixture, and finally half of the chicken mix. Repeat the layers one more time, finishing with the chicken on top. Sprinkle the whole thing with mozzarella cheese.
Step 3
Pop it in the oven and bake for about 30 to 35 minutes, until the top is nice and golden. Let it rest for 5 minutes before digging in—it helps everything set and makes it easier to serve.
